Output 93a604e0d0dffa9b6862afb1b2096fd2568b7a4117850b20e1813935b88bf6e6:0

value
526007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2150da99d63c45b9a3a6199ab3eb4b902a3b29d6 OP_EQUAL
address
34jB5hgoEhYkAagvxtQqjTtgCbf3cWMZFa
transaction
93a604e0d0dffa9b6862afb1b2096fd2568b7a4117850b20e1813935b88bf6e6